The Ultimate Creamy & Tangy Homemade Tartar Sauce

Make this easy homemade tartar sauce in minutes. It is creamy, tangy, and the perfect dipping sauce for fried fish, crab cakes, and shrimp. You will not go back to store-bought after trying this simple recipe.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up sweet pickle relish, drained
  • 2 tablespoons finely chopped dill pickles
  • 1 tablespoon capers, drained and ch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 teaspoon fresh dill, chopped
  • 1/2 teaspo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• Pinch of salt
  • Pinch of black pepper

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ine the mayonnaise, sweet pickle relish, chopped dill pickles, chopped capers,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, fresh dill, and fresh parsley.
  2. Mix all ingredients together until they are fully incorporated and the sauce is smooth.
  3. Season the mixture with a pinch of salt and black pepper to taste.
  4. Cover the bowl and chill the tartar sauce in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together.
  5. Serve your zesty tartar sauce with crispy fish, crab cakes, or as a tangy dipping sauce for fries.

Notes

  • For a copycat version similar to Culver’s, use finely minced sweet pickle relish and slightly increase the amount of lemon juice for extra tang.
  • If you prefer a smoother sauce, use only sweet pickle relish instead of adding extra chopped dill pickles.
  • This homemade tartar sauce keeps well in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.
